Free PCR for kidney dialysis patients in Butwal



BUTWAL: The Butwal Sub-Metropolitan City has managed free PCR test on the patients receiving regular dialysis for kidney disease.

The kidney patients undergoing dialysis would be tested for COVID-19 prior to giving dialysis services.

Butwal Sub-Metropolis Mayor Shivaraj Subedi shared that those receiving dialysis and living temporarily and permanently in the Butwal Sub-Metropolis would be provided free PCR test.

The medical team would reach out to the kidney patients on dialysis to their own residence to collect the nasal and throat swabs.

There are around 600 kidney patients receiving dialysis services in Butwal and surrounding areas.
